Your Eyes Everywhere, Without the Hassle

These cameras are designed for discreet, effortless placement. Each unit is a compact 2.8 x 2.8 x 1.6 inches, boasting a robust weather-resistant design that shrugs off dust and water. Setup? It's genuinely straightforward. They run on two AA lithium batteries, which Blink claims can last up to two years, depending on activity. The bundle includes everything you need: batteries, mounting hardware, and a Sync Module Core that effortlessly integrates with your home Wi-Fi.

Once installed, the blink's new 2k outdoor cameras capture crisp 2K video (2,560 × 1,440) with a generous 135-degree field of view. This means you can cover most entryways or driveways without constant adjustments. In real-world use, footage is remarkably sharp, delivering enough detail to clearly identify faces or license plates from a reasonable distance. Imagine seeing exactly who dropped off that package, or checking on your kids playing in the backyard from your phone.

Beyond just video, these cameras offer a suite of advanced features. You get two-way audio to speak with visitors or deter unwanted guests, instant motion alerts directly to your phone, and clear night vision. There's even a built-in temperature sensor that can notify you if conditions cross a set threshold--perfect for monitoring a detached garage or shed (Digital Home Trends, 2024). What's more, the blink's new 2k outdoor system introduces AI-generated event descriptions, summarizing what your camera sees, so you don't have to wade through hours of footage.

But here's where it gets tricky: to truly unlock many of these advanced features, including cloud-stored video clips and AI summaries, you'll need a Blink subscription plan. Prices start at $3.99 per month for a single camera, or $11.99 per month for unlimited cameras (with AI features starting at $6.99 for one camera). Without a subscription, you lose access to cloud storage. Another consideration is ecosystem support. While the cameras integrate seamlessly with Amazon Alexa and IFTTT, they don't currently support Apple HomeKit or Google Home. This might matter if your smart home is built on those platforms.
